Hamilton involved 2026 F1 guidelines will make automobiles “fairly gradual” · RaceFans

June 7, 2024
in Racing
0
Home Racing
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


Lewis Hamilton believes Components 1 must go additional to scale back the burden of automobiles regardless of the deliberate minimize for 2026 introduced yesterday.

The FIA revealed the primary particulars of the brand new laws for 2026 together with a discount within the minimal weight from 798 kilograms to 768.

“It’s solely 30 kilos, so it’s getting in the appropriate course, but it surely’s nonetheless heavy,” stated Hamilton. The following era of automobiles will likely be heavier than these raced in 2021.

The FIA expects groups will be capable of obtain the discount in weight partly via a discount within the most dimensions of the automobiles. The 2026 automobiles will likely be shorter and narrower than the present machines.

Nonetheless the automobiles will even generate considerably much less downforce than earlier than, leaving Hamilton involved lap instances will rise. “I’ve spoken to some drivers who’ve pushed it on the simulator – I haven’t – however they stated it’s fairly gradual. So we’ll see whether or not it’s really the appropriate course or not.”

Nonetheless he believes F1 is heading in the appropriate directed by making {the electrical} element of the hybrid engines extra highly effective and introducing sustainable gas.

“When it comes to sustainability, significantly on the ability unit facet, I feel that’s a very daring step and I feel it’s getting in the appropriate course,” he stated. “We’ve simply acquired to ensure the automobiles are environment friendly, quick, and a pure step ahead, and truly racing is improved.”
